description Guangdong news/ Current financial difficulties in Guangdong. Protest movement in Guangzhou against the special examination and levy on agricultural products. New dyke to be built in the Zhujiang River. Troops force civil residents to buy military bonds. Guangxi army counterattack Leiyang and the report. Pessimism on the rice market in Guangzhou. Fortification building in Humen. Mint in Guangzhou to stop production. Leather firms to be temporarily closed as a strike. Ghost in tea house in Guangzhou. Ferry hijacked in Jiangmen. Mines in Gaoming. Craft industry in Zhaoqing. Taishan closes public and private schools. Communist bandits in Dongjiang area. Bandit chieftain Liang Leigong is arrested in Xinhui. Bandits in Shunde. New rice on sale in local Guangdong. Prices of silk products going down. Communists in Guangxi. Epidemic in Fuzhou, Fujian province.
